All those information can be found in Oracle server documentation...

But when consider using partitioning, you must ensure you have Enterprise edition bought by you or your company. This feature is not available to Personal Oracle 8 or Oracle 8 standard edition. And ensure someone in your company knows about it before installation because managing various partitions is not easy. Make sure you have several harddisks to benefit from this new feature.
